Network Installation Engineer Bristol | On-site | Monday-Friday, 37.5 hours Up to 150 per day | Outside IR35 | 6-month contract BPSS Clearance Required TRIA are delighted to be working with a leading organisation to recruit an experienced Network Installation Engineer for a 6-month contract in Bristol.
This is a fully site-based role for a hands-on engineer with strong cabling experience and a commitment to quality workmanship and safe working practices.
The Role You ll join an installation team delivering network infrastructure projects, with responsibility for: Installing network cabinets, containment and Cat5e/Cat6/Cat6A cabling.
Terminating, testing and labelling copper and fibre cabling.
Installing and patching network switches.
Installing fibre optic cabling via internal, pit and duct routes.
Fibre termination, patching, testing and troubleshooting.
Using OTDR equipment for fibre testing and fault finding.
Completing QA documentation and daily shift reports.
Working to project plans, RAMS and site procedures while maintaining a safe and tidy environment.
What We re Looking For Proven experience terminating fibre optic cables, including cold cure and splicing.
Strong copper cabling experience, including Cat5e/Cat6.
Experience testing copper and fibre using Fluke testers.
Good knowledge of current network installation practices.
Experience working to high standards within a close team.
